Start with a Clean, Scalable Product Catalog
Before you worry about pricing or advertising, get your product catalog right. Why? Because a disorganized catalog is the silent killer of conversions and SEO.
For PrestaShop startups, this is your foundation. Without a clean, scalable catalog, you’ll hit roadblocks when expanding to marketplaces or scaling your product range.
Key pillars of a healthy catalog:
- Accurate and unique product titles
- Structured variants (size, color, packaging, etc.)
- Proper categorization aligned with both PrestaShop and external marketplaces
- Standardized attributes (brand, dimensions, barcode/EAN, SKU)

Embrace Marketplace Expansion Early
Selling only on your .com site isn’t enough. Shoppers today move across channels, and omnichannel sellers grow 190% faster than single-channel brands (Harvard Business Review).
Go Multichannel From Day One
As a PrestaShop startup, leverage your early momentum by plugging into:
- Prestashop Addons Marketplace (the official plugin ecosystem)
- Regional players like Cdiscount, Fnac, Allegro, or Bol.com
- Global giants like Amazon, eBay, and Etsy
- Emerging social marketplaces like TikTok Shop and Meta Commerce

Prioritize Customer Experience & Post-Purchase Touchpoints
According to Salesforce’s 2024 State of the Connected Customer report, 80% of shoppers say the experience a brand provides is as important as its products.
For PrestaShop startups, this means going beyond the sale to create memorable, trustworthy, and seamless shopping experiences.
Speed, Transparency & Flexibility Are Non-Negotiable
Here’s what today’s consumers expect:
- Fast and predictable delivery (with tracking links that actually work)
- Simple return policies clearly stated pre-checkout
- Click & Collect options, especially valued by EU shoppers in urban areas
- Localized communication via email/SMS for delivery updates and support

Track KPIs and Adapt Fast
KPIs Every PrestaShop Startup Should Monitor:
- Conversion rates (by channel, device, campaign)
- Product-level performance (bestsellers vs dead stock)
- Cart abandonment rates (and recovery success)
- Fulfillment KPIs (shipping speed, error rates)
- Pricing competitiveness and margin trends
